CNET News has an interesting little story about Evite, who distribute calendars. Not only did they get the dates of the major Jewish holidays wrong this year (they apparently listed the 2002 dates) - the calendar list Yom Kippor as a "Day to Party":

"In addition, we also wish to apologize for having listed Yom Kippur as one of our 'Reasons To Party,'" the mea culpa continued. "We understand and respect that Yom Kippur is a Day of Atonement, a day to be taken seriously to reflect and fast, and as such, one of the most important Jewish Holidays in the year."
